Hewer Berlany Santos, Assault on a Federal Officer, California 2023

Hewer Berlany Santos, 30, of Los Angeles, California, has been sentenced to 21 months in prison for assaulting a federal correctional officer. Santos was sentenced by U.S. District Judge Dena M. Coggins on August 21, 2023.

According to court documents, on August 21, 2023, Santos intentionally struck a federal correctional officer in the face while he was working at a federal prison in Herlong in Lassen County. The correctional officer sustained cuts and abrasions to his face which necessitated medical attention.

This case was the product of an investigation by the Federal Bureau of Prisons and the Federal Bureau of Investigation. Assistant U.S. Attorney Haddy Abouzeid prosecuted the case.
